Discover this beautifully renovated one bedroom apartment in one of Torontos most vibrant neighbourhoods, perfectly situated at Dundas and Roncesvalles. Designed with the working professional, student or minimalist in mind. This sleek space features high-end finishes including quartz kitchen countertops, a gas range, microwave, and custom wood cabinetry. The ceramic-tiled bathroom is modern and pristine. There are two split heating and cooling units for personalized comfort year-round and your very own ensuite laundry for the cherry on top! Enjoy an oversized window in the bedroom to sock up the sunrise and a skylight, this unit is filled with natural light. Ideal for those who appreciate well designed spaces this unit offers a beautifully finished home. Steps from transit, cafes, delicious restaurants, shops and High Park of course!
